What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Dq Treat's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the initial franchise fee for a captive-venue location is $25,000. This fee is paid in a lump sum when the franchise application is submitted to ADQ.

It's important to note that this fee is generally nonrefundable, as stated in Item 5 of the FDD, but there may be conditions where the initial franchise fee is refundable or reduced. Prospective franchisees should carefully review Item 5 for these specific conditions. Additionally, if a franchisee pays the full initial franchise fee, they can send one person to Dq Treat's training program without incurring a training fee.

Understanding the initial franchise fee is a critical first step in evaluating the overall investment required to open a Dq Treat franchise. Franchisees should also consider other initial costs, such as training fees, travel expenses, and construction consultation services, as outlined in Item 7 of the FDD. These additional costs can significantly impact the total initial investment.
